Non-precious metal carbamates as catalysts for the aziridine/CO2 coupling reaction under mild conditions

摘要
The catalytic potential of a large series of easily available metal carbamates (based on thirteen different non-precious metal elements) was explored for the first time in the coupling reaction between 2-arylaziridines and carbon dioxide, working under solventless and ambient conditions and using tetraalkylammonium halides as co-catalysts. The straightforward synthesis of novel [NbCl3(O2CNEt2)(2)], Nb-Cl, and [NbBr3(O2CNEt2)(2)], Nb-Br, is reported. The niobium complex Nb-Cl, in combination with NBu4I, emerged as the best catalyst of the overall series to convert aziridines with small N-alkyl substituents into the corresponding 5-aryl-oxazolidin-2-ones.
